Very nice car, rare T-top, second adult owner, never wrecked or hot rodded.

EXTERIOR

Custom body off paint, 1972 Corvette Orange Metallic/Black, custom Fiero logos under hood and trunk.

INTERIOR

Has tilt wheel, electric windows, AM/FM radio with cd player, new speakers in seats, new windshield, new weather stripping, new flawless, one of a kind, custom seats from Mr. Mike's Leather (FL), delay wipers, custom carpet to match custom paint, custom made structural steel roll bars, very nice LED chip lighting. Very clean interior.

 

MECHANICAL

New brake system (calipers, master cylinder, pads, power booster).

New cooling system (fan motor, thermostat, all hoses).

New clutch system (clutch master cylinder, slave cylinder, heavy duty clutch and pressure plate).

New shocks and struts.

Engine is original and has been totally gone over - All new gaskets, all sensors replaced, new distributor, rotor and cap, accell wires, and plugs. All vacuum lines have been replaced. All hoses have been replaced.

New exhaust manifolds. New coil. New EGR and tube. Titanium carbon fiber heat wrap on exhaust system. New high heat wrapping on electrical wires where heat affected and all other wires re-wrapped. New motor mounts. New transaxle mounts. New battery. New timing chain and gears. New water pump. New fuel pump and filter. New alternator. New a/c compressor, filter and dryer (not yet charged, has 1+ years warranty remaining).  New custom paint on engine. New throttle body. New carpet in trunk area.

Almost all parts are still under warranty (O'Reilly Auto Parts) and I will provide receipts on most items.

I have two second place, San Antonio Car Show trophies that were given prior to the completion of the interior and engine.

 

Drives GREAT. 30+ MPG (HWY).

Over 12K invested in restoring.

Hate to sell it but I need to for medical reasons.

 

These are the only things that I know of that need to be done on this car:

Parking Break cable needs to be replaced. Rebuilt headlight motors (can be manually lifted). Replace clutch and brake panel pads.

NHTSA could add 1M cars to GM recall

Wed, 13 Mar 2013


The Detroit Free Press is reporting that the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ration may expand a recall campaign for faulty brake lamps. The agency is currently looking into complaints that certain 2004-2011 Chevrolet Malibu models as well as some 2007-2009 Saturn Aura sedans may have brake lights that do not illuminate when the driver presses the pedal. Alternatively, the lamps may also illuminate without input from the driver. General Motors recalled 8,000 Pontiac G6 models from the 2005 model year for the same problem, and NHTSA is currently investigating whether to add 550,000 more G6 models built between 2005 and 2009 to the list for the same issue.
In addition, investigators are currently examining 97 complaints from Malibu and Aura owners with the same trouble. If NHTSA adds those models to the recall campaign, more than one million units could be covered. GM, meanwhile, says there have been no accidents or injuries as a result of the problem.

eBay Find of the Day: 1967 Pontiac GTO Monkeemobile

Sun, 29 Apr 2012

Say what you will about The Monkees, but the guys in the band had great taste in automobiles. Take the Monkeemobile, for example. Built off a 1967 Pontiac GTO Convertible, the custom featured genuinely interesting bodywork and some wild engine bolt-ons. If you're a fan of 1960s pop and yearn to relive the genre's glory days, eBay Motors may have what you need. A recreation of the 1967 Monkeemobile has showed up for auction. This particular replica was built by Dakota County Customs using an four-speed GTO, just like the original.
Built for the band's 45th anniversary and the final Monkees tour last year, this Monkeemobile is faithful down to every last detail. Unfortunately, the trumpet exhaust poking out of the front fender wells and the massive gold-flake blower are for show only. Seems fitting.
If you like what you see, this machine is up for bid in Richfield, Minnesota with two days left on the auctions. So far, bidding as whipped up to $60,000 with the reserve not met. Head over to eBay Motors to have a look.

General Lee takes on Bandit T/A in classic Hollywood car showdown [w/poll]

Fri, 26 Aug 2011

You don't have to be born in the 1960s or 1970s to be able to recognize the General Lee from The Dukes of Hazzard and the Pontiac Trans Am from Smokey and the Bandit. These old school four-wheeled stars seem to transcend demographics thanks to the miles of film that show the orange 1969 Dodge Charger and the jet-black 1977 Pontiac Trans Am performing seemingly impossible stunts.
The folks at Hot Rod magazine are obviously hip to this fact, and they put together a fun video in tribute of the instantly recognizable duo. Hit the jump to watch on as Sam Young and James Smith replace Bo Duke and The Bandit for a bit of dirt-road shenanigans in a pair of otherwise well cared for classics. We're not so sure we'd call it the best chase scene ever, but it sure looks like a lot of fun.
